retro rocket
1.0.0

想像一下當前的改變,英國廣播公司(BBC)微觀一直在蓬勃發展並發展到今天。在此替代方案中,此操作系統與Windows和Linux一起存在,但分開。
這是受Acorn MOS 3.20啟發的替代操作系統,但現代化了當前的硬件作為思想實驗,並且可以玩一些玩具。
它的userland完全基於BBC Basic的基本方言編寫,完全訪問了硬件(就像過去一樣),多任務處理,現代文件系統支持,Internet公用事業以及更多以及通過磁盤圖像等與ADFS(例如Adfs)的橡子功能的向後兼容。
x86_64系統啟動ISO映像(更多選項即將推出)該操作系統通過Limine Bootloader啟動,僅在64位系統上運行。在可能的情況下,它將利用SMP系統(多核) - 操作系統的這一部分正在重寫。
啟動後,操作系統將首先運行/programs/init這是一個簡單的基本腳本,它將CHAIN Shell, rocketsh 。 rocketsh支持直接基本命令(例如打印,變量分配,功能和過程調用,評估等)。任何未知的說明都將被解釋為命令, rocketsh將在/programs中搜索將被CHAIN匹配程序名稱。
請注意,在此操作系統中, CHAIN指令不會用新程序替換當前程序(在BBC Micro上,它可以做到這一點,就像Posix exec() )相反,它將當前程序置於等待狀態,啟動新程序,而在新程序結束時,將舊程序延續到舊程序中。使用此功能您可以產生相關程序功能的複雜樹。 CHAIN到背景和立即返回的能力即將到來。